Govt submits oil and gas bill to House

Tuesday, October 3 2000 - 10:00 AM WIB

The government submitted on Tuesday the oil and gas draft bill to the House of Representatives for deliberations.

"We submitted the bill today after it was approved by the Vice President Megawati Soekarnoputri," Minister of Energy and Mineral Resource Purnomo Yusgiantoro said on Tuesday on the sidelines of the visit to gas stations to examine impacts of fuel price increases.

The bill, which will replace the Oil and Gas Law No. 8/1971 on state oil and gas company Pertamina, aims at liberalizing the country's oil and gas industry and stripping Pertamina of its decades-long monopoly rights on the country's oil and gas industry. (godang)
